AS-IP Tech, Inc. is a small technology company focused on internet protocol (IP) and communications equipment. It develops networking and connectivity solutions aimed at businesses and organizations that need to manage and transmit data over networks. The company operates in the broader communications equipment industry, which includes hardware and software used to move information between devices and systems.

AS-IP Tech generates revenue through the sale of its communications products and related services. The company appears to be very early-stage or in a transitional phase, as its reported gross and operating margins are effectively zero, suggesting minimal or no active revenue at this time. Its unusually high ROIC figure likely reflects accounting factors rather than strong operational performance. The main risk facing AS-IP Tech is execution — it must prove it can build a working product, find paying customers, and compete against much larger, well-funded communications equipment companies before it runs out of resources.
